NWS Forecaster Discussion




Area forecast discussion 
National Weather Service Pendleton or 
755 PM PDT Monday Jun 17 2013 


Short term...tonight and Tuesday...low pressure system off the 
coast continues to trigger instability over the forecast area. For 
rest of tonight most of the convection will be across the west and 
northern portion of the forecast area. Expect some isolated 
thunderstorms to continue well into tonight so I added them in the 
evening update. So far most thunderstorms have just contained brief 
heavy rain and some gusty but some small hail is still possible. 


The low pressure system will move closer to the coast on Tuesday 
increasing the chance of thunderstorms across the forecast area as 
well as the potential for stronger storms. 


&& 


Previous discussion... /issued 534 PM PDT Monday Jun 17 2013/ 


Short term...tonight through Thursday. With upper low offshore and 
southerly flow over the region low level instability is increasing. 
Cumulus is developing mainly over the higher terrain. 18z NAM 
continues the trend of scattered showers and isolated thunderstorms 
developing late afternoon and continuing into the evening with 
possible showers through the overnight period as well. Cloud cover 
should keep low temperatures fairly mild with many locations staying 
in the 50s. The upper low moves closer to the coast on Tuesday. 
Expect another day of scattered showers and thunderstorms. With the 
jet overhead tomorrow any storms that develop have better potential 
to be stronger. Surface temperatures will be cooling as 850mb temperatures 
show a large decrease. Forecast will have highs about 10 degrees 
cooler than today. The low moves directly across the region Tuesday 
night and Wednesday. Models are generating some pretty good amounts 
of rain. Will continue with showers and thunderstorms however the 
potential for a good stratiform area of rain on the eastern side of 
the low exists. Additional airmass cooling plus cloud cover will 
bring high temperatures down into the 60s for most areas. Models differ on 
have fast the low will move off to the east Thursday with the GFS 
showing a much better chance of showers continuing through the day. 
Forecast will be a blend of the GFS and NAM with chance showers and 
continued cool temperatures. 94 


Long term...Thursday night through Monday...mid/upper level low 
over Pacific northwest Thursday night will keep a chance of showers 
over the Blue Mountains. Low continues over region on Friday with 
forecast area on southern flank of low, which imposes a northwest 
flow aloft and thus downslope winds with sinking air across lower 
elevations for dry conditions. However, there will be chance of 
showers over the Blue Mountains and east slopes in central 
Washington Cascades during the day on Friday. Friday night the low 
moves east into Idaho/Montana for a chance of showers in the evening 
on the Blue Mountains, but downslope winds and attendant sinking air 
elsewhere over the forecast area will yield dry conditions Friday 
night. Through the weekend a middle/upper level ridge of high pressure 
will produce sinking air and thus dry conditions for Saturday and 
Sunday. Monday a large middle/upper level trough in the Gulf of Alaska 
pushes a cold front into the region for increasing chance of showers 
mainly over the mountains. Included a slight chance of thunderstorms 
for Monday afternoon/evening. Polan
